Geometric Control for Unified Entangling Quantum Gate with High-Fidelity in Electric Circuit
Authors:Lin Xu  Gang Huang  Y H Ji and Z S Wang
Institution:1.College of Physics and Communication Electronics,Jiangxi Normal University,Nanchang,China;2.Key Laboratory of Optoelectronic and Telecommunication of Jiangxi,Nanchang,China;3.Applied and Technologic Center of Modern Education,Jiangxi Normal University,Nanchang,China
Abstract:Implements for geometric quantum gates are analyzed in the electric circuit. We find that, by operating the difference of geometric phase between eigenstates of Hamiltonian for single-particle system and two-particle system respectively, one may perfectly preserve the messages for single-particle gate as well as entangling geometric two-particle gate.
